> libhadoop calls {{dlopen}} to load {{libsnappy.so}} and {{libz.so}}. These
> libraries can be bundled in the {{$HADOOP_ROOT/lib/native}} directory. For
> example, the {{-Dbundle.snappy}} build option copies {{libsnappy.so}} to this
> directory. However, snappy can't be loaded from this directory unless
> {{LD_LIBRARY_PATH}} is set to include this directory.
> Should we also search {{java.library.path}} when loading these libraries?
